我正在尝试从 Overleaf v1 迁移到 v2,以利用 TeXLive 2017(v1 为 2016),但 Overleaf v2 不包含 Symbola 字体,我依靠该字体来提供偶尔的 unicode 字符,例如 ⓧ 或 ⌘,以及哪种字体是包含在 v1 中。
我正在尝试遵循 Overleaf 帮助文档“我想要将自定义字体加载到文档中。我该怎么做?“
我Symbola.ttf
从 George Douros下载了
古代文字的 Unicode 字体,并且我已将此文件上传至 Overleaf v2 中 LaTeX 项目的根目录。
因为 Symbola 内置于 v1,所以为了呈现 unicode 字符,我所要做的就是执行一个命令,例如\fontspec{Symbola}{\symbol{"2468}}
获取“带圆圈的 9”。
尽管我已将Symbola.ttf
文件上传到我的 Overleaf 项目,但这些命令仍然不起作用——我确信是因为我需要告诉 Overleaf 查看 Symbola.ttf。
fontspec
Overleaf 帮助文档中引用的命令,例如,(\setmainfont{[CrimsonText-Regular.ttf]}
或\setsansfont
和\setmonofont
)似乎针对您将用作主要的字体。相反,我只是想\fontspec
临时识别 Symbola。
我应该发出什么命令或任何咒语来让 LaTeX / Overleaf 知道,当我说时\fontspec{Symbola}{\symbol{"2468}}
,我希望 LaTeX / Overleaf 在我的 Overleaf 项目的根目录中找到 Symbola.ttf 文件?